ا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

الردود الموصى بها

قام بنشر (معدل)

السلام عليكم ورحمة الله

كما هو واضح أعلاه

لو أن لنا زر أمر يقوم بمعاينة أو طباعة تقرير

والكود هو


Private Sub print_Click()

On Error GoTo Err_print_Click


Dim stDocName As String


stDocName = "re1"

DoCmd.OpenReport stDocName, acNormal


Exit_print_Click:

Exit Sub


Err_print_Click:

MsgBox Err.Description

Resume Exit_print_Click


End Sub

كيف أجعل كبسة الكيبورد f12 مثلا تقوم مقام ذلك الكود

وبارك الله بالجميع

تم تعديل بواسطه أبو العقاب
قام بنشر

لست بحاجة الى هذه الاكواد فعندما تفتح التقرير للمعاينة اضغط على Ctrl+P

وهذا الكود اثبته كما طلبت زيادة في الفائدة


Private Sub print_KeyDown(KeyCode As Integer, Shift As Integer)

Dim stDocName As String

If KeyCode = vbKeyF12 Then

stDocName = "re1"

DoCmd.OpenReport stDocName, acNormal

End If

End Sub

قام بنشر (معدل)

بارك الله بك أبا خليل

وحيّاك الله

وصلت الفائدة

لست بحاجة الى هذه الاكواد فعندما تفتح التقرير للمعاينة اضغط على Ctrl+P

أحيانا يتطلب الأمر أن تستخدم مفاتيح الكيبورد لتحل محل بعض الأوامر

فمثلا للخروج من البرنامج قد يحتاج المبرمج الضغط على مفتاح esc بدل الأزرار

على العموم أجدد شكري

وبوركت

تم تعديل بواسطه أبو العقاب

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information